Dunwoody Singers 2013

 

The Dunwoody Singers, under the direction of Yvonne Miller, Music Teacher, Dunwoody Elementary School, participated in the annual District 4 Choral Festival Large Group Performance Evaluation at Avondale First Baptist Church last week. The group, which is composed of 3rd - 5th Grade students at Dunwoody Elementary received one Superior and two Excellent ratings from the judges. Some of the judges comments included: "Well disciplined singers with a lovely developing tone - a joy to hear!"

Dunwoody has an enhanced 9-1-1 service called Smart911 available for free to all residents. The Chattahoochee River 9-1-1 Authority is encouraging all citizens to create a Safety Profile at www.smart911.com, and provide 9-1-1 with the information they need to assist you in the event of an emergency. A profile can include as much or as little information as you want, such as:


  • Members of your family and any medical conditions, medications or allergies

  • Mobile phone numbers tied to home or work addresses

  • Your emergency contacts, vehicle information and even pets

Smart911 is 100% private and secure. The only time a profile is seen is when you call 9-1-1. The profile immediately displays to call takers, which allows first responders to assist you faster and more effectively. Create you profile today at www.smart911.com
